    "content": "__find_resource_space() currently uses resource_contains() but for\ntentative resources that are not yet crafted into the resource tree. As\nresource_contains() checks that IORESOURCE_UNSET is not set for either\nof the resources, the caller has to hack around this problem by\nclearing the IORESOURCE_UNSET flag (essentially lying to\nresource_contains()).\n\nInstead of the hack, introduce __resource_contains_unbound() for cases\nlike this.\n\nSigned-off-by: Ilpo Järvinen <ilpo.jarvinen@linux.intel.com>\n---\n include/linux/ioport.h | 20 +++++++++++++++++---\n kernel/resource.c      |  4 ++--\n 2 files changed, 19 insertions(+), 5 deletions(-)",
    "diff": "diff --git a/include/linux/ioport.h b/include/linux/ioport.h\nindex 5533a5debf3f..19d5e04564d9 100644\n--- a/include/linux/ioport.h\n+++ b/include/linux/ioport.h\n@@ -304,14 +304,28 @@ static inline unsigned long resource_ext_type(const struct resource *res)\n {\n \treturn res->flags & IORESOURCE_EXT_TYPE_BITS;\n }\n-/* True iff r1 completely contains r2 */\n-static inline bool resource_contains(const struct resource *r1, const struct resource *r2)\n+\n+/*\n+ * For checking if @r1 completely contains @r2 for resources that have real\n+ * addresses but are not yet crafted into the resource tree. Normally\n+ * resource_contains() should be used instead of this function as it checks\n+ * also IORESOURCE_UNSET flag.\n+ */\n+static inline bool __resource_contains_unbound(const struct resource *r1,\n+\t\t\t\t\t       const struct resource *r2)\n {\n \tif (resource_type(r1) != resource_type(r2))\n \t\treturn false;\n+\n+\treturn r1->start <= r2->start && r1->end >= r2->end;\n+}\n+/* True iff r1 completely contains r2 */\n+static inline bool resource_contains(const struct resource *r1, const struct resource *r2)\n+{\n \tif (r1->flags & IORESOURCE_UNSET || r2->flags & IORESOURCE_UNSET)\n \t\treturn false;\n-\treturn r1->start <= r2->start && r1->end >= r2->end;\n+\n+\treturn __resource_contains_unbound(r1, r2);\n }\n \n /* True if any part of r1 overlaps r2 */\ndiff --git a/kernel/resource.c b/kernel/resource.c\nindex bb966699da31..1e2f1dfc0edd 100644\n--- a/kernel/resource.c\n+++ b/kernel/resource.c\n@@ -754,7 +754,7 @@ static int __find_resource_space(struct resource *root, struct resource *old,\n \t\t/* Check for overflow after ALIGN() */\n \t\tavail.start = ALIGN(tmp.start, constraint->align);\n \t\tavail.end = tmp.end;\n-\t\tavail.flags = new->flags & ~IORESOURCE_UNSET;\n+\t\tavail.flags = new->flags;\n \t\tif (avail.start >= tmp.start) {\n \t\t\talloc.flags = avail.flags;\n \t\t\tif (alignf) {\n@@ -765,7 +765,7 @@ static int __find_resource_space(struct resource *root, struct resource *old,\n \t\t\t}\n \t\t\talloc.end = alloc.start + size - 1;\n \t\t\tif (alloc.start <= alloc.end &&\n-\t\t\t    resource_contains(&avail, &alloc)) {\n+\t\t\t    __resource_contains_unbound(&avail, &alloc)) {\n \t\t\t\tnew->start = alloc.start;\n \t\t\t\tnew->end = alloc.end;\n \t\t\t\treturn 0;\n",
